Suspected armed herdsmen have reportedly killed several people in a fresh attack on communities in Mbaterem, Ukum Local Government Area of Benue State, in the early hours of Sunday.

The attackers, reportedly riding motorcycles, invaded Ayaba, Ukpen, Bom, Aboajio and Yina communities at about 5 am, shooting sporadically and forcing residents to flee into the bushes for safety.

A resident, Emmanuel Oryiman Mbatsavdue, said four people had been confirmed dead in Aboajio alone, while residents continued searching for missing family members.

He added that the casualty figure could rise as the search continued.

The Executive Chairman of Ukum LGA, Hon. Jonathan Modi, confirmed that an attack occurred but said the exact number of casualties was yet to be established.

He said security operatives were still in the bush assessing the situation.

When contacted, the spokesman of the Benue State Police Command, DSP Orchia Aondogwu, confirmed that there was an attack in Ukum Local Government Area.

He said more details would be communicated as soon as they became available.
